Custom Cap Fabrication & Installation
Albertson’s mid-century chimneys weren’t built to standard modern dimensions, and the big-box store caps simply don’t fit properly. An incorrectly sized cap on a converted gas chimney causes poor draft and acidic condensate pooling, rapidly degrading original clay tile liners. We measure on-site and fabricate custom caps that account for your flue count, your chimney’s exact dimensions, and your exposure conditions. Custom cap installation in Albertson ranges from $420–$780 for stainless or copper configurations designed to withstand coastal corrosion.
Crown Coating
For crowns with early-stage cracking that hasn’t yet compromised the structural masonry, crown coating is a cost-effective preventive measure that can add 10–15 years of service life. We use professional-grade formulations — including HeatShield and Gelco products — that flex with thermal expansion rather than cracking again the first winter. In Albertson’s climate, with repeated freeze-thaw and salt exposure, this is often the smartest money you can spend on chimney protection. Common Chimney Cap & Crown Problems We See in Albertson Homes
- Abandoned oil flues left uncapped allow decades of leaf and moisture buildup, leading to hidden liner collapse that only surfaces when a new owner tries to use the fireplace for the first time. We find this constantly in Albertson’s older Cape Cods where the oil boiler was decommissioned years ago but nobody ever capped the chimney.
- Freeze-thaw cycles crack mortar joints and crowns on exposed masonry, worsened by salt-laden air from nearby Manhasset Bay accelerating erosion beyond what inland Long Island communities experience. By March, we’re repairing crowns that were intact in October.
- Incorrectly sized caps on converted gas chimneys cause poor draft and acidic condensate pooling, rapidly degrading original clay tile liners. The cap that “fit” your oil chimney often chokes a gas appliance.
- Original 1950s–1960s clay tile liners disintegrating from acidic condensate after oil-to-gas conversion, with moisture intrusion through cracked crowns accelerating the damage. The liner you can’t see is often in worse shape than the crown you can.
